E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
车锁
C++构造函数加不加explicit?90%程序员都踩过的坑!(附最佳实践)
在C++中,构造函数前的explicit关键字就像一道"安全
锁
",防止编译器偷偷做你不想要的类型转换。但有些情况下,不加explicit反而更灵活!
CheungChunChiu
·
2025-04-20 05:57
c++
开发语言
qt
构造函数
zookeeper分布式
锁
实现
zookepeer分布式
锁
是通过zookeeper临时有序节点特性实现的zookeeper实现分布式
锁
的算法流程假设
锁
空间的根节点为/lock:客户端连接zookeeper,并在/lock下创建临时的且有序的子节点
呼呼通
·
2025-04-20 02:34
分布式
zookeeper
精准自动化获取——VIN车辆识别代码查询_精准版API
一、引言在当今车水马龙的世界中,每一辆
车
都拥有独特的品牌、报价和构造,而VIN(车辆识别代码)就是它的身份证。
Romantic Rose
·
2025-04-20 01:30
汽车市场
人工智能
Verilog基础学习二
Verilog基础学习二文章目录Verilog基础学习二一、always块1.阻塞性赋值和非阻塞性赋值二、条件语句1.if语句基本用法2.避免引入
锁
存器3.case语句4.casez语句三、归约运算符(
浅举个栗子
·
2025-04-20 01:59
Verilog语言
fpga开发
分布式
锁
框架Lock4j
分布式
锁
框架Lock4j文章目录分布式
锁
框架Lock4j1.Lock4j基本介绍1.1Lock4j的背景与发展历程1.2主要特性与优势2.Lock4j核心架构解析2.1三层
锁
模型图解2.2独创的
锁
心跳机制
北执南念
·
2025-04-20 00:25
工作中开发总结
分布式
Flink 窗口、Scala泛型通配符、Flink 窗口的底层 API、解析 json 格式的数据
目录Flink窗口TimeWindowSessionWindowCountWindowFlink窗口的底层API卡口过
车
需求案例解析json格式的数据导入fastjson依赖fastJson解析json
赤兔胭脂小吕布
·
2025-04-19 15:57
scala
flink
json
大数据
java
分布式
锁
方案三 Zookeeper 实现机制分析
ZooKeeper分布式锁机制分析ZooKeeper是一个开源的分布式协调服务,其强一致性(CP)和节点有序性,使它非常适合实现强一致性分布式
锁
,尤其在金融、电商、调度系统等高一致性要求场景中广泛使用。
将臣三代
·
2025-04-19 13:37
Java面试专项
分布式
zookeeper
面试
分布式锁
并发
实现机制
深入理解synchronized
•Monitor通过monitorenter和monitorexit指令实现
锁
的获取与释放。当线程进入
、、揽明月九天
·
2025-04-19 11:25
java
轻松掌握Java多线程 - 第五章:synchronized关键字
文章目录学习目标1.对象
锁
与类
锁
的概念1.1对象
锁
(实例
锁
)1.2类
锁
(静态
锁
)1.3对象
锁
与类
锁
的对比2.synchronized修饰方法与代码块的区别2.1修饰方法vs修饰代码块2.2不同
锁
对象的选择
qianmoQ
·
2025-04-19 09:43
轻松掌握Java多线程
java
python
jvm
完整的 .NET 6 分布式定时任务实现(Hangfire + Redis 分布式
锁
)
完整的.NET6分布式定时任务实现(Hangfire+Redis分布式
锁
)以下是完整的解决方案,包含所有必要组件:1.基础设施层1.1分布式
锁
服务//IDistributedLockService.cspublicinterfaceIDistributedLockService
码上有潜
·
2025-04-19 08:06
hangfire
Redis
.net
分布式
redis
缓存击穿问题
(比如某文章)用分布式
锁
来解决分布式
锁
:就是当有一个节点获取到
锁
后,其他节点是不可以获取
锁
的为了解决这个文章的缓存击穿问题,我用的是Redis分布式
锁
,理由如下:Redis分布式
锁
:它追求的高可用性和分区容错性
蔡蓝
·
2025-04-19 06:27
缓存
Java对象内存结构详解
JVM(开启压缩指针)下的典型布局:1.对象头(Header)对象头包含运行时元数据和控制信息,占12字节(压缩指针)或16字节(未压缩)(1)MarkWord(8字节)存储对象自身的运行时数据,内容会随
锁
状态变化
qian_qh
·
2025-04-19 06:55
jvm
Java锁机制深度解析:
锁
的分类与代码实现
Java锁机制深度解析:
锁
的分类与代码实现一、
锁
的基础认知1.1
锁
的核心价值在多线程编程中,
锁
是保障数据一致性的基石。
以恒1
·
2025-04-19 05:19
java
开发语言
零成本守护网站安全!免费SSL证书申请攻略
提升信任:使网站地址栏显示“HTTPS”和
锁
图标,增加用户信任。改善SEO:搜索引
·
2025-04-19 02:44
sslhttps
如何查看https证书是否到期?https证书到期了怎么办?
如何查看HTTPS证书是否到期使用浏览器检查:打开网站,点击地址栏左侧的
锁
图标。选择“证书”或“连接是安全的”选项,查看证书的有效期。
·
2025-04-19 02:44
sslhttps
高并发系统三大利器之缓存(原理到应用场景)
目录一、高并发系统三大利器二、缓存的使用场景2.1减轻DB压力2.2提高系统响应2.3session分离2.4分布式
锁
三、缓存的分类3.1客户端缓存3.2网络端缓存3.3服务端缓存四、缓存的优势和代价4.1
小飞飞的技术笔记
·
2025-04-19 01:24
架构
Redis
Spring
缓存
redis
数据库
eureka
现在纠结于到底是学stm32好还是Arduino好?
每当我在论坛上看到这个问题,总是忍不住想笑,因为这就像在问"我是该先学骑三轮
车
还是直接学摩托车?"。
·
2025-04-18 22:38
浅析MySQL事务
锁
在MySQL中,事务
锁
是用于确保数据一致性和并发控制的重要机制。事务
锁
可以帮助防止多个事务同时修改同一数据,从而避免数据不一致和脏读、不可重复读、幻读等问题。
香蕉可乐荷包蛋
·
2025-04-18 20:22
sql
mysql
数据库
OpenGauss体系架构
负责全局协调与监控,包括:监听客户端连接请求,创建新会话线程(如Postgres线程)处理请求监控所有子线程状态,对异常退出的线程进行重启或数据库重初始化初始化共享内存、信号量池等核心资源,但不直接参与
锁
管理或数据操作
LILL...
·
2025-04-18 20:21
OpenGauss
数据库
gaussdb
database
架构
学习
笔记
深入理解SoC上电和boot流程
主要从事ISP/MIPI/SOC/
车
规芯片设计/SOC架构设计首发于知乎专栏:芯片设计进阶之路微信公众号:芯片设计进阶之路(x_chip)转发必须授权,同时保留这段声明,盗版必究!
烓围玮未
·
2025-04-18 19:48
单片机
嵌入式硬件
嵌入式硬件自学思路 | PCB设计零基础入门-小白适用(附详细入门经验分享)
学完以后智能
车
硬件轻松搞定。目录前言选择一款设计软件好的入门课程掌握抄板元件采购焊板子烙铁头热风枪自己半设计明确设计需求全设计最后选择一款设计软
自动化小秋葵
·
2025-04-18 19:13
stm32
PCB
嵌入式硬件
嵌入式
原理图
echarts的柱状图使用
柱体顶部使用外部图片相关代码import*asechartsfrom'echarts'exportdefault{data(){return{jqrwChart:null,active:0,xData:['公交
车
'
拾荒旧痕
·
2025-04-18 17:33
echarts
echarts
前端
javascript
python 多线程 多核_为什么python的多线程不能利用多核CPU?
原因:因为GIL,python只有一个GIL,运行python时,就要拿到这个
锁
才能执行,在遇到I/O操作时会释放这把
锁
。
weixin_39639698
·
2025-04-18 13:31
python
多线程
多核
【2024年华为秋招(留学生)-9月25日-第一题(100分)-最好的通勤体验】(题目+思路+Java&C++&Python解析+在线测试)
不同线路上的公交
车
会在规定的路线上单向循环行驶,例如708708708路公交的路线为[2,5,82,5,8
塔子哥学算法
·
2025-04-18 13:59
华为
算法
数据结构
深度解析跨境支付之产品架构
其中包括购汇及申报、结汇及申报、换汇(包含汇率查询和外汇兑换、远期
锁
汇等功能)、境外本地下单、查询、退款、外汇跨境收款、海外代发、VA账户开户及余额查询、VCC发卡及查询等能力。
RobinCode
·
2025-04-18 11:21
跨境支付体系
跨境支付
产品架构
【JavaEE初阶】多线程重点知识以及常考的面试题-多线程进阶(二)
初阶若有问题评论区见❤欢迎大家点赞评论收藏分享如果你不知道分享给谁,那就分享给薯条.你们的支持是我不断创作的动力.王子,公主请阅要开心要快乐顺便进步1.synchronized原理1.1加锁工作过程1.1.1偏向
锁
1.1.2
薯条不要番茄酱
·
2025-04-18 08:35
java-ee
java
开发语言
阿里云CentOs ClickHouse安装
作者主页:青花
锁
简介:Java领域优质创作者、Java微服务架构公号作者简历模板、学习资料、面试题库、技术互助文末获取联系方式ClickHouse安装目录前言1、检查服务器上clickhouse情况2、
青花锁
·
2025-04-18 08:02
项目实战
Java微服务
阿里云
centos
clickhouse
linux
linux脚本
shell
深入剖析Redis分布式
锁
:Redlock算法源码解读与实战
《深入剖析Redis分布式
锁
:Redlock算法源码解读与实战》一、分布式
锁
的挑战与Redlock的诞生1.1单机Redis
锁
的局限性//单机Redis
锁
示例(SETNX+EXPIRE)Jedisjedis
猿享天开
·
2025-04-18 06:21
java
开发语言
Java并发-AQS框架原理解析与实现类详解
AQS(AbstractQueuedSynchronizer)是Java并发包(JUC)的核心基础框架,它为构建
锁
和同步器提供了高效、灵活的底层支持。
Cloud_.
·
2025-04-18 06:19
java
AQS
JUC
Java并发
ReentrantLock
Redisson分布式
锁
深度解析:原理、源码与最佳实践
什么是Redisson分布式
锁
?分布式
锁
是分布式系统中确保资源互斥访问的核心机制,而Redisson作为基于Redis的Java客户端,提供了高效且功能丰富的分布式
锁
实现。
Cloud_.
·
2025-04-18 06:48
分布式
Redis
Redisson
分布式锁
synchronized 重量级
锁
的核心原理详解
本文仅探讨重量级
锁
的原理,暂不涉及
锁
升级过程。
Brpaddle
·
2025-04-18 02:22
java
jvm
【Python】进程、线程、协程详解及使用场景解析
目录基础概念:进程、线程、协程的解析GIL全局解释
锁
什么时候使用多进程?什么时候使用多线程?什么时候使用协程?
kdayjj966
·
2025-04-17 23:34
python
智能汽车 eSIM 卡的 CCRC 认证:车联网安全实践
CCRC(中国网络安全审查技术与认证中心)认证在保障智能汽车eSIM卡安全方面发挥着至关重要的作用,通过严格的认证流程和标准,为
车
DPLSLAB6
·
2025-04-17 20:40
汽车
安全
网络
十六、条件变量和信号量
head=NULL;while(head==NULL){//我们想让代码在这个位置阻塞//等待链表中有了节点之后再继续向下运行//使用到了后面要讲的条件变量‐阻塞线程}//链表不为空的处理代码条件变量是
锁
吗
您813
·
2025-04-17 14:05
Linus
linux
c语言
【微服务】SpringBoot 整合 Lock4j 分布式
锁
使用详解
目录一、前言二、Lock4j概述2.1Lock4j介绍2.1.1Lock4j是什么2.1.2Lock4j主要特征2.1.3Lock4j技术特点2.2Lock4j支持的
锁
类型2.3Lock4j工作原理2.4Lock4j
小码农叔叔
·
2025-04-17 12:22
springboot
入门到精通项目实战
微服务治理与项目实战
Lock4j
分布式锁
Lock4j分布式锁使用
Lock4j
使用
Lock4j
使用详解
Lock4j
lock4j
GPU 算力:驱动数字时代的核心引擎(下篇)
一、新兴领域拓展:GPU算力重构产业边界(一)智能制造:工业数字化的核心驱动力在工业仿真领域,ANSYSFluent的CFD流体仿真通过GPU分布式计算将百万级网格计算效率提升60%,某新能源
车
企借助劲速云
·
2025-04-17 12:54
企业怎样申请SSL证书?
一般来说,企业网站使用SSL证书需要经过选购证书,提交申请,证书签发,安装部署等环节,完成这些步骤之后网站原有的http协议就会变成https,会有
锁
型的加密标识,表示网站加密工作完成
·
2025-04-17 12:53
MySQL索引底层数据结构算法、优化以及
锁
与事务整理
目录一、索引数据结构实现:1.1、二叉树1.2、红黑树1.3、Hash表1.4、B-Tree结构(BTree)1.5、B+Tree结构(B-Tree变种:BPlusTree)二、MyISAM和InnoDb存储引擎索引实现2.1、MyISAM存储引擎索引实现2.2、InnoDb存储引擎索引实现2.3、联合索引——索引最左前缀原理2.4、MyISAM和InnoDB的应用场景三、Explain工具分析S
图灵农场
·
2025-04-17 07:17
个人笔记
mysql
数据结构
2025鸿蒙开发面试题汇总——通俗易懂
答案:鸿蒙是“分布式操作系统”,比如你可以用手机操控电视、手表联动,数据自动同步(比如手机导航流转到
车
机),安卓做不到这种跨设备协作;另外鸿蒙系统更轻量,适合智能家居等小内存设备。
前端菜鸡日常
·
2025-04-17 04:01
鸿蒙开发
harmonyos
华为
Redisson分布式
锁
实现及原理详解
随着技术快速发展,数据规模增大,分布式系统越来越普及,一个应用往往会部署在多台机器上(多节点),在有些场景中,为了保证数据不重复,要求在同一时刻,同一任务只在一个节点上运行,即保证某一方法同一时刻只能被一个线程执行。在单机环境中,应用是在同一进程下的,只需要保证单进程多线程环境中的线程安全性,通过JAVA提供的volatile、ReentrantLock、synchronized以及concurr
小希与阿树
·
2025-04-17 01:39
分布式
Java设计模式——单例模式
文章目录Java单例模式概念满足条件两种形式设计要求饿汉模式懒汉方式懒汉式多线程解决方案synchronized双检查
锁
方式静态内部类枚举(别瞎用)Java单例模式概念单例模式是Java中最简单的设计模式之一
我心向阳iu
·
2025-04-16 23:59
设计模式
Java面试知识点精讲
java
单例模式
开发语言
2025年4月15日 百度一面 面经
cglib可以代理被final修饰的类吗,为什么3.JVM体系结构4.垃圾回收算法5.什么是注解如何使用底层原理6.synchronized和reentrantlock7.讲一下你项目中redis的分布式
锁
与
Dddddduo_
·
2025-04-16 19:32
#
底层原理
面试八股
java
开发语言
JVM:对象的实例化、直接内存
当堆内存空间较为规整时,采用指针碰撞法;若堆内存空间不规整,则使用空闲列表法随后对对象的变量进行默认赋值,按照类中变量声明的顺序进行再为对象设置对象头,对象头包含对象所属类在方法区中的地址、对象的哈希值、分代年龄、
锁
状态标志等信息最后依次调用
qw949
·
2025-04-16 19:01
JVM
jvm
华为OD机试2025A卷 - 停车场车辆统计(100分)
停车场车辆统计真题目录:点击去查看2025A卷100分题型题目描述特定大小的停车场,数组cars[]表示,其中1表示有车,0表示没
车
。
无限码力
·
2025-04-16 18:55
华为OD机考真题刷题笔记
华为od
华为OD2025A卷真题
华为OD机考2025A卷真题
华为OD机试2025A卷真题
JAVA并发编程 - Lock的底层原理
二、Lock的使用三、AbstractQueuedSynchronizer1、定义2、内部结构3、实现原理4、公平
锁
和非公平
锁
四、ReentrantLock内部结构五、ReentrantLock获取
锁
流程非公平
锁
尝试获取
锁
的过程当前线程加入双向链表的过程首节点自旋过程小结六
安德鲁(Andrew)
·
2025-04-16 17:44
JAVA基础
java
java-ee
后端
红宝书第四十五讲:状态管理核心工具详解:RxJS & Redux & MobX的奇妙世界
查看总目录:红宝书学习大纲一、状态管理:像仓库管理员管理物资典型场景:当多个页面/组件需要共享数据时(例如用户登录信息、购物
车
数据),需要一个集中管理机制。
·
2025-04-16 15:57
前端javascript
MVCC多版本并发
共享
锁
和排它锁也叫读
锁
和写
锁
。读
锁
是共享的,不会阻塞其它读
锁
读数据,但会阻塞其它写
锁
;写
锁
是排它
扁豆的主人
·
2025-04-16 13:19
mysql
mysql
java
数据库
行锁(Row Locking)和MVCC(多版本并发控制)
以下是详细对比和适用场景分析:一、行锁(RowLocking)1.核心原理阻塞式并发控制:通过加锁(共享
锁
、排他
锁
)直接阻止其他事务访问被锁定的数据。
huingymm
·
2025-04-16 12:45
面试学习使用
数据库
【开篇:机器学习:新能源汽车研发的“数据炼金术“】
在新能源
车
试验场,每一次碰撞测试要消耗70万元,电池包循环测试耗时超过1000小时,ADAS场景库建立需要数万个cornercases。这不是简单的资源消耗,而是工程师们面临的效率瓶颈。
新能源汽车--三电老K
·
2025-04-16 08:21
模型+硬件在环
机器学习
汽车
人工智能
ubantu执行sudo chown -R username xxx(文件夹)命令失效
设置完后共享文件夹显示
锁
标记(文件夹的权限对当前用户设置为只读)。
qing22222222
·
2025-04-16 07:42
ubuntu
上一页
24
25
26
27
28
29
30
31
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他